WitrynaThe term developed country, or advanced country, is used to categorize countries with developed economies in which the tertiary and quaternary sectors of industry dominate. This level of economic development usually translates into a high income per capita and a high Human Development Index (HDI). Witryna1 lip 2024 · Just since 2003, the number of low-income countries has nearly halved, declining from 66 to 31 in 2024. The number of high-income countries is currently 80, up from less than 50 in the 1990s.
